In the 170th episode of Cash Flow Pro, we talk with Randy Langenderfer from InvestArk Properties, LLC.
Randy has many hats. He has 25+ years of various corporate leadership experiences, mainly in the risk and governance areas. He serves as the Chief Compliance and Audit Officer for a large academic medical institution in Houston, TX. He has a b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Information Systems, an MBA in Finance, and is a CPA. Randy is also a husband, father, and grandfather.
Randy’s first real estate experience was as a private money lender for single-family remodeling. He later personally invested in a duplex before starting to grow his passive investment portfolio and later investing as a general partner. Today, Randy has invested in over 4,000 units and will tell us why looking into new assets is always a good idea.
